On September 9th when everybody came back to school, they all saw the same familiar faces, as well as six new unfamiliar faces. Those six unfamiliar faces are the new teachers here at Mountain View.
Hillary Campbell, Susan Evans, Matt Fox, Bibiana Gomes, Holly Graham and Sandy Webb are the six new teachers whom you may have seen around the halls. Hillary Campbell, who teaches clothing levels 1-4 and child development 1-3, transferred here from Sprague High School in Salem. Campbell has been enjoying her time here at MVHS.

Susan Evans is taking the place of Mr. Plants in the choir department. She teaches Concert, Jazz, and Mixed Choir. She has been preparing the choir for their first choral performance coming up in a few weeks.

Matt Fox just transferred to MVHS from Bend High and is currently teaching Journalism, News Staff, and Read180.
“I love the school atmosphere, the staff is really friendly, plus I have a classroom with windows, how awesome is that?!” It looks like Fox is very enthusiastic about this school year, and he is looking forward to seeing what the year may bring.

Mountain View gladly welcomes newcomer teacher Bibiana Gomes to the staff. Gomes teaches metals and natural resources. Before Gomes got a job at MVHS, she was working as a student teacher in Molalla, Oregon.

In the science department we have newcomer Sandy Webb who teaches Physical Science and Biology. Webb came all the way from Hawaii to be here at MVHS.
“It’s a good school, I’m lucky to be here. The people in the science department, and the office are really nice. I have some good students, a couple rascals, but still good students.”

Holly Graham transferred here from Santana High School in Santee, California, there she taught Social Studies. Graham currently teaches Spanish here at MVHS.
